BrandBox Locator
Icon of the box ATM - Link
ATM - LinkATM
Picture of the location

Address: Homerton Row, Lower Clapton, Homerton, London Borough of Hackney, London, Greater London, England, E9 6BW, United Kingdom

General Information

Operator: Link

Last verified: 9/19/23

Location
Openstreetmap Information
amenity
atm
check_date
2023-09-19
level
1
operator
Link
Edit